I'm not entirely sure this is a bug - it could well be argued this is mis-configuration on our part, and there's a trivial workaround, but I'll leave the cloud-init devs to make that call. The configuration is as follows: 1. On recent Ubuntu classic images for the Raspberry Pi, cloud-init's seed is located on the boot partition (/dev/mmcblk0p1, labelled "system- boot"). This is desirable as it's a straight-forward FAT partition, and thus easily accessible and editable on any OS (as opposed to the original seed location on the root ext4 partition). 2. Cloud-init is configured to look for its seed with "fs_label: system- boot" 3. Systemd is configured (via /etc/fstab) to mount /dev/disk/by-label /system-boot (/dev/mmcblk0p1) on /boot/firmware The result on boot-up is one of three situations: 1. cloud-init mounts /dev/mmcblk0p1 on a temp path. While attempting to read its seed, systemd attempts to mount /dev/mmcblk0p1 on /boot/firmware but fails because the device is already mounted elsewhere. cloud-init succeeds in reading its seed, umounts /dev/mmcblk0p1 and the system boots successfully, but /boot/firmware isn't mounted (leading to issues further down the line with other things like flash-kernel that expect it to be mounted). 2. cloud-init checks for /dev/mmcblk0p1 in /proc/mounts, and doesn't see it there. It goes to mount /dev/mmcblk0p1 on a temp path, but before it can do so, systemd mounts it on /boot/firmware. cloud-init's mount fails (device already mounted), so it fails to read its seed and uses a default config instead (which isn't entirely desirable for us as the default involves a long wait if ethernet is not connected; our default seed overrides that). 3. Everything works fine. This occurs when either a) systemd mounts /boot/firmware first, then cloud-init sees this mount in /proc/mounts and uses it or b) cloud-init mounts /dev/mmcblk0p1 on a temp path, reads its seed and unmounts it, *then* systemd mounts /boot/firmware. The relevant code is mount_cb() in util.py which is calling mounts() to read /proc/mounts then attempting to mount the device when it's not found (leading to a classic race between the check and the action). It might be argued that it should simply attempt the mount, and check /proc/mounts in the event of failure, but I'm wary that mounting FS' is a potentially costly exercise (can the seed be on a remote mount?), and there's probably edge cases here I'm unaware of (is it possible, perhaps dangerous, to double-mount certain devices?). Perhaps it could be adjusted to check /proc/mounts, attempt the mount, then *re-check* /proc/mounts in the case of failure? Nevertheless, there's a trivial work-around in our case: just add an override for "RequiresMountFor=/boot/firmware" to our systemd config for cloud-init-local, thus ensuring the mount is definitely available prior to cloud-init looking for its seed.
